出版時(shí)間:2009-9 出版社:清華大學(xué)出版社 作者:楊少波 主編 頁(yè)數(shù):383
Tag標(biāo)簽:無(wú)
內(nèi)容概要
本書(shū)共13章,內(nèi)容分為5大部分。前5章主要介紹如何組織和實(shí)施課程設(shè)計(jì)、如何進(jìn)行項(xiàng)目的需求分析和系統(tǒng)的體系架構(gòu)設(shè)計(jì)、類(lèi)設(shè)計(jì)以及正確和合理地創(chuàng)建對(duì)象; 第6~8章主要說(shuō)明如何提高應(yīng)用系統(tǒng)的性能和降低系統(tǒng)各個(gè)層次組件的耦合度; 第9~11章主要是為讀者介紹如何高效、高質(zhì)量地進(jìn)行項(xiàng)目開(kāi)發(fā)實(shí)現(xiàn),以及如何評(píng)審和度量代碼的質(zhì)量; 第12章主要介紹如何進(jìn)行團(tuán)隊(duì)協(xié)作開(kāi)發(fā)、版本控制和管理; 第13章主要介紹如何實(shí)施課程設(shè)計(jì)的答辯和項(xiàng)目的文檔管理。 本書(shū)適合作為承擔(dān)國(guó)家技能型緊缺人才培養(yǎng)培訓(xùn)工程的高等院校和示范性軟件學(xué)院的計(jì)算機(jī)應(yīng)用與軟件工程專(zhuān)業(yè)的課程設(shè)計(jì)類(lèi)教學(xué)和學(xué)習(xí)輔導(dǎo)參考教材,也可作為自學(xué)和急需了解J2EE技術(shù)平臺(tái)的軟件項(xiàng)目開(kāi)發(fā)和實(shí)現(xiàn)的相關(guān)技術(shù)和知識(shí)的技術(shù)人員的參考書(shū)。當(dāng)然,也適用于各類(lèi)職業(yè)技能培訓(xùn)機(jī)構(gòu)作為提高學(xué)員項(xiàng)目開(kāi)發(fā)能力的培訓(xùn)指導(dǎo)教材。
書(shū)籍目錄
第1章 課程設(shè)計(jì)的項(xiàng)目實(shí)施和管理 1.1 課程設(shè)計(jì)的意義及教學(xué)目標(biāo) 1.1.1 制定課程設(shè)計(jì)的教學(xué)目標(biāo) 1.1.2 開(kāi)展課程設(shè)計(jì)之前的預(yù)備知識(shí)和技術(shù) 1.2 制定課程設(shè)計(jì)計(jì)劃和技術(shù)要求 1.2.1 項(xiàng)目分組和人員角色分工原則 1.2.2 制定待開(kāi)發(fā)項(xiàng)目中各種形式文檔的規(guī)范 1.2.3 課程設(shè)計(jì)中的項(xiàng)目選型 1.3 課程設(shè)計(jì)中推薦的項(xiàng)目示例 1.3.1 藍(lán)夢(mèng)教育集團(tuán)教育信息化系統(tǒng) 1.3.2 正方商業(yè)集團(tuán)客戶(hù)關(guān)系管理系統(tǒng) 1.4 指導(dǎo)教師的主要職責(zé)和階段任務(wù)分配 1.4.1 課程設(shè)計(jì)中指導(dǎo)教師的主要職責(zé) 1.4.2 指導(dǎo)教師布置項(xiàng)目開(kāi)發(fā)各個(gè)階段的任務(wù) 本章小結(jié) 本章練習(xí)第2章 統(tǒng)一建模語(yǔ)言在項(xiàng)目開(kāi)發(fā)中的應(yīng)用 2.1 軟件系統(tǒng)功能性和非功能性需求的正確描述 2.1.1 利用需求清單描述系統(tǒng)中的功能性和非功能性需求 2.1.2 利用UML用例圖描述系統(tǒng)中的功能性需求 2.2 用例事件流和用例規(guī)約的描述方式 2.2.1 用例事件流和用例規(guī)約 2.2.2 利用UML順序圖描述用例的事件流 2.2.3 利用UML活動(dòng)圖完善對(duì)用例事件流的描述 2.3 軟件系統(tǒng)設(shè)計(jì)中的概要設(shè)計(jì) 2.3.1 軟件系統(tǒng)概要設(shè)計(jì)中的系統(tǒng)架構(gòu)設(shè)計(jì) 2.3.2 系統(tǒng)概要設(shè)計(jì)中的組件設(shè)計(jì) 2.3.3 系統(tǒng)概要設(shè)計(jì)中的類(lèi)結(jié)構(gòu)和關(guān)系的設(shè)計(jì) 2.3.4 系統(tǒng)概要設(shè)計(jì)中實(shí)體類(lèi)結(jié)構(gòu)和關(guān)系的設(shè)計(jì) 2.4 軟件系統(tǒng)設(shè)計(jì)中的詳細(xì)設(shè)計(jì) 2.4.1 業(yè)務(wù)層中的業(yè)務(wù)邏輯建模及業(yè)務(wù)功能類(lèi)的設(shè)計(jì) 2.4.2 業(yè)務(wù)流程分析、描述和設(shè)計(jì) 2.5 軟件系統(tǒng)的部署和發(fā)布 本章小結(jié) 本章練習(xí)第3章 達(dá)到高內(nèi)聚低耦合的架構(gòu)設(shè)計(jì)目標(biāo) 3.1 面向?qū)ο蟮南到y(tǒng)架構(gòu)設(shè)計(jì) 3.1.1 面向?qū)ο蟮募軜?gòu)設(shè)計(jì)能夠適應(yīng)不斷變化的軟件系統(tǒng)需求 3.1.2 可擴(kuò)展性和可重用性是面向?qū)ο蠹軜?gòu)設(shè)計(jì)的主要目標(biāo) 3.1.3 如何保證系統(tǒng)架構(gòu)設(shè)計(jì)結(jié)果的可擴(kuò)展性和可重用性 3.1.4 如何能夠在軟件系統(tǒng)架構(gòu)設(shè)計(jì)中重用和簡(jiǎn)化設(shè)計(jì)結(jié)果 3.2 面向切面的系統(tǒng)架構(gòu)設(shè)計(jì) 3.2.1 面向切面架構(gòu)設(shè)計(jì)是對(duì)面向?qū)ο蠹軜?gòu)設(shè)計(jì)的進(jìn)一步擴(kuò)展和完善 3.2.2 面向切面架構(gòu)設(shè)計(jì)在J2EE平臺(tái)中的具體實(shí)現(xiàn)和應(yīng)用 3.2.3 基于面向切面思想的系統(tǒng)架構(gòu)設(shè)計(jì)實(shí)現(xiàn)交易日志示例 3.2.4 基于面向切面思想的系統(tǒng)架構(gòu)設(shè)計(jì)實(shí)現(xiàn)事務(wù)控制示例 3.2.5 基于面向切面思想的系統(tǒng)架構(gòu)設(shè)計(jì)實(shí)現(xiàn)性能監(jiān)控示例 3.2.6 基于面向切面思想的系統(tǒng)架構(gòu)設(shè)計(jì)實(shí)現(xiàn)安全功能示例 3.3 面向服務(wù)的軟件系統(tǒng)架構(gòu)設(shè)計(jì) 3.3.1 企業(yè)信息化平臺(tái)及信息化應(yīng)用系統(tǒng)的環(huán)境是異構(gòu)狀態(tài) 3.3.2 面向服務(wù)的軟件系統(tǒng)體系架構(gòu) 3.3.3 面向服務(wù)架構(gòu)的實(shí)現(xiàn)技術(shù) 本章小結(jié) 本章練習(xí)第4章 進(jìn)行類(lèi)設(shè)計(jì)以降低類(lèi)的耦合度第5章 創(chuàng)建對(duì)象以降低類(lèi)關(guān)系的耦合度第6章 分離Web表示層數(shù)據(jù)處理和展現(xiàn)邏輯第7章 提高Web應(yīng)用系統(tǒng)的響應(yīng)性能第8章 實(shí)現(xiàn)Web頁(yè)面中數(shù)據(jù)分頁(yè)功能第9章 編程開(kāi)發(fā)多線(xiàn)程安全的項(xiàng)目代碼第10章 高效和高質(zhì)量地編程開(kāi)發(fā)和實(shí)現(xiàn)第11章 評(píng)審和度量項(xiàng)目中代碼的編程質(zhì)量第12章 保持團(tuán)隊(duì)協(xié)作開(kāi)發(fā)的一致性第13章 課程設(shè)計(jì)答辯和文檔管理參考文獻(xiàn)
圖書(shū)封面
圖書(shū)標(biāo)簽Tags
無(wú)
評(píng)論、評(píng)分、閱讀與下載
250萬(wàn)本中文圖書(shū)簡(jiǎn)介、評(píng)論、評(píng)分,PDF格式免費(fèi)下載。 第一圖書(shū)網(wǎng) 手機(jī)版